Alphabet Analysis
| Vav | v as in vine; marks long ō / ū | |
| Shin | shin with right dot; sin with left dot | |
| Sheva | silent sheva — no sound; closes the syllable | |
| Mem | m as in mother | |
| Patach | short 'ah' as in father | |
| Resh | r guttural, like the French r | |
| Sheva | silent sheva — no sound; closes the syllable | |
| Tav | t as in top | |
| Seghol | short 'eh' as in met | |
| Mem Sofit | final form of Mem — at word end |

About this coordinate
Leviticus 20:8:1 is a BCV:P reference — Book · Chapter · Verse · Word Position. It addresses word 1 of Leviticus 20:8, so the Hebrew word וּשְׁמַרְתֶּם֙ (ushmartem) can be cited, linked and studied at exactly this position rather than somewhere in the verse. In the Biblical Knowledge Coordinate System the same position is written Lev.20.8.W1, which extends further down to each syllable (Lev.20.8.W1.S1) and character.
